Informed nims / ics field guide for national responses


This 3" x 5" reference guide clearly and concisely outlines what you need to know about NIMS objectives, whether you're at the local, state or federal level, and in private industry. The all-hazards, non-jurisdictional or discipline specific guide also provides responsibilities and checklists for applying the Incident Command System (ICS).
Tough, waterproof, and alcohol-fast, this handy guide can be used for NIMS and ICS training, during training and functional exercises and, most importantly, in the field where you need it most. Combine this guide with your training and feel confident that your NIMS compliance requirements are met.
* NIMS Overview and Major Components
* Multi-Agency Coordination System
* Incident Command System Concepts
* Position-Specific Prompts for Command and Operations
* Sample ICS Organizational Charts
* Planning Process and Cycle
* Incident Action Plan (IAP)
* NIMS/ICS Glossary and Acronyms
* ICS Position Responsibilities and Checklists
